Crevasses and serracs
From Aosta hut you rise about 250 meters over the morrain. then you will meet the serracs to rise on the upper plateu of the Grand Murailles glacer.
In the summer 2007 the way up was quite on the left, mainly on steeped ice.
On the way up the crevasses can overcome quite easily. But be very carefull during the way down.
With the sun the snow melt and the ice is exposed and dengerouse.
It took us some time to safely deswcend this 100 meters of the glacer
